Self-Reliance (SR) is a quarterly 100-page homesteading magazine that has articles on gardening, canning, cooking, DIY projects, livestock, foraging, and preparedness. SR does not have articles on firearms or politics, believing that readers want a break from controversial topics just as football fans want a break from politics. Whether you live deep in the woods or on the top floor of a high-rise apartment, we truly believe you can enrich your life by becoming more self-reliant.
